Common Carrier Air Duct Cleaning Problems We Solve in League City

  • Disconnected flex duct boots from floor registers. The rapid 1990s–2000s construction boom across League City left thousands of homes with single-screw clamps securing Carrier duct boots. In South Shore Harbour, we regularly find these have failed completely, drawing raw attic air—insulation fibers, humidity, mold spores—directly into living spaces with no visible sign at the grille.
  • Moisture pooling at low-point sags in flex duct runs. League City’s year-round Gulf humidity condenses inside attic-mounted flex duct, especially at hanger sag points. This moisture colonizes inside Carrier Performance Series FE4A/B plenums, producing the musty odor homeowners often blame on the air handler itself.
  • Unsealed boot connections accelerating corrosion. Salt-laden Bay air infiltrates through unsealed returns, corroding flex duct collar clamps faster here than in inland Galveston County suburbs. We’ve replaced corroded Carrier collars in Tuscan Lakes that failed in under ten years—half their expected lifespan.
  • Post-Harvey microbial contamination in duct insulation. Hurricane Harvey pushed catastrophic moisture into thousands of League City attics even where living spaces stayed dry. Carrier systems in 77573 and 77574 still carry residual mold in flex duct insulation that standard filter changes never address.
  • Infinity Series variable-speed airflow mismatched to degraded ductwork. Carrier’s Infinity FE4ANB air handlers modulate airflow precisely, but that sensitivity exposes every leak and restriction in aging flex systems. We clean and seal so the technology actually performs as designed.

Carrier Service in League City: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ment

League City sits directly on Clear Lake and Galveston Bay, and that coastal position creates a duct-degradation profile we don’t see even thirty miles inland. The persistent Gulf moisture infiltrates flex duct systems standard in the city’s post-1990 suburban build-out, then gets trapped inside attics that regularly hit 130°F+ in summer. In South Shore Harbour and Tuscan Lakes, this combination drives mold and microbial colonization inside Carrier ductwork at rates far exceeding inland Houston suburbs—making duct cleaning here a moisture and mold issue first, a dust issue second.

For Carrier owners specifically, this means the Comfort Series air handler you installed fifteen years ago may be circulating air through duct boots that were never properly secured during original construction. The Performance Series FE4A you bought for its humidity control can’t compensate for flex runs that have been drawing unconditioned attic air since the Clinton administration. We’ve mapped this pattern across enough League City homes to know which subdivisions used which shortcuts, and we check every connection point with a camera before we quote any work.

Carrier Service Pricing in League City

Service Typical Range
Standard residential duct cleaning (single system) $350 – $550
Duct cleaning + flex duct repair (2–3 boots) $550 – $750
Full cleaning, sealing, and antimicrobial treatment $650 – $850
Video inspection (standalone or add-on) $125 – $175
Dryer vent cleaning (bundled with duct service) $75 – $125

What drives cost: system size, accessibility of attic runs, number of disconnected boots requiring repair, and whether post-Harvey microbial treatment is needed.
